A newly established FM station is a champion station here in Ghana. Do the FM stations have the mandate to honor themselves with titles like a champion?
Can you name one champion station of your choice, as all of them are self-styled champions? The self-acclaimed titles are not over, we have an apostolic church internationally owned by one pastor yet, it has only one church building with a handful of the congregation.
What is wrong to say nkyeremu news international since the network is also global?